About Mirko Ledda

Mirko Ledda is a scholar working on Molecular Biology, Sensory Systems, Nutrition and Dietetics, Oncology and Physiology, having authored 19 papers that have together received 399 indexed citations. Recurring topics across this work include RNA and protein synthesis mechanisms (5 papers), Biochemical Analysis and Sensing Techniques (4 papers), RNA modifications and cancer (4 papers), Olfactory and Sensory Function Studies (3 papers), Bone health and osteoporosis research (3 papers), RNA Research and Splicing (3 papers), Bone health and treatments (3 papers) and Bone Metabolism and Diseases (2 papers). The work is most often cited by research in Sensory Systems (70 citations), Nutrition and Dietetics (112 citations), Endocrine and Autonomic Systems (24 citations), Orthopedics and Sports Medicine (22 citations) and Physiology (62 citations). Mirko Ledda has collaborated with scholars based in Italy, United States and Switzerland. Frequent co-authors include Sharon Aviran, Johannes le Coutre, Gastone Marotti, Alberta Zallone, Fei Deng, Ulrich K. Genick, Nicolas Godinot, Sven Bergmann, Koichi Sameshima and Nathalie Martin. Their work appears in journals such as Calcified Tissue International, Bioinformatics, Human Molecular Genetics, G3 Genes Genomes Genetics and Genes.
